Please re-read my post. I was talking about Long Beach Island, New Jersey, NOT SOWAL. In Jersey, you buy a badge for either a week or a day. You do not have to wear it, just present it if you are asked. Teenagers and college students walk the beaches daily to sell them. Lifeguards will also report large holes to superiors if warnings are not heeded.

We were "tipped" to this issues about 10 days ago. We made a public records request and then scheduled a meeting with the Public Works Director. The Public Works Department is where the contract is funded.

When we reviewed the contract with the Director he told the WCTA that the contract was actually written in Human Resources. We asked for the scope of services document in the contract and he stated that the document did not exist. He also agreed that the contract was open ended, not-bid and no hourly rate was specified within the document. The contract began in March and the vendor has billed around $2000.00 per month.

He promised to look at the expenditure in light of the 8.2 million in cuts that must be made in the upcoming budget cycle.

If this contract was discussed during the Budget Scrubs, I missed it.
